Senior Thesis Reflection
   
 
The Penn State Senior Thesis Project revolved around the design and construction techniques regarding Office Building 1 of the CityCenterDC development. During the fall semester, three in-depth technical reports were created. These reports aimed at compiling information about the existing building design and construction methods. In the spring semester, three proposals were conducted in an effort to find alternative solutions to the more challenging issues of the project. All of the work was then compiled into a final report and presentation. The senior thesis taught me how to efficiently research and analyze building systems while looking for alternative means to a problem.
